Secret Service Director James Murray steps down and will join Snap as chief security officer, reporting directly to Evan Spiegel (Matt Berg/Politico)

Matt Berg / Politico:
Secret Service Director James Murray steps down and will join Snap as chief security officer, reporting directly to Evan Spiegel  —  U.S. Secret Service Director James Murray will retire after serving in the high-ranking post for three years, President Joe Biden and first lady Jill Biden said in a statement on Thursday.
